My practice is exclusive to the representation of clients in matters of U.S. immigration and nationality law. I have a broad knowledge and experience in family-based petitions, waivers, immigrant and nonimmigrant visas, DACA, and US citizenship.
I was born and raised in Texas. I received my law degree from Seattle University School of Law in 2008. I am admitted to the Washington State Bar Association and the Ninth Circuit Court of Appeals. I am a member of the American Immigration Lawyers Association--Washington and Texas Chapters.
